    1910 Bolo

    Looking for something else I ran across this knife, forgot I had it. I collect Carbines and this doesn't fit my collection must be why I put it away.

    Reading in Cole's #3 page 21, it is a Model 1910 Bolo. It says Springfield Armory made 59,095 of these between 1910-1918. This one is marked 1912.

    The scabbard is different then the one shown in Cole's book. But it has the catch for the thumb release.

    I was told the stuff on the blade was blood, so I left it. I know, stories are just stories. But it sounded good when he told me.

    M1910 Bolo

    JimF4M1sicon-That is the nicest bolo I have ever seen.Beautiful correct bright blade w/blue handle and touch of blue in front of the handle. Scabbard is likewise very neat. Someone knew how to work leather. Looks like they kept the wooden rawhide wrapped scabbard body and professionally placed it in leather. Or-- you have a new, yet unheard of, contract variation.
